Customer Solutions Manager Jobs in Rhode Island: Frequently Asked Questions
How do you become a customer solutions manager in Rhode Island?
Most customer solutions manager roles in Rhode Island require a bachelor's degree in business, communications, or a related field, combined with experience in account management or customer-facing roles. No state-issued license applies to this role. Rhode Island employers in financial services and healthcare technology typically prefer candidates who have progressed from coordinator or associate roles within the same industry, and familiarity with the industries dominant in Providence strengthens any application significantly.

Are there remote customer solutions manager jobs in Rhode Island?
Yes, and they are relatively common given that customer solutions management is primarily a desk-based, communication-driven role. About 64% of customer solutions manager openings tied to Rhode Island are remote or hybrid as of July 2026, reflecting the role's strong fit with distributed work arrangements. Client onboarding, account reviews, and relationship management tasks are the functions most frequently performed fully remotely.
How can I get hired as a customer solutions manager in Rhode Island with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path is a customer success associate or account coordinator role at one of Rhode Island's financial services or healthcare technology firms, where internal promotion into a solutions manager title is common. Employers like Amica Mutual and regional healthcare IT companies regularly hire entry-level client services staff. A Salesforce administrator certification or demonstrated CRM experience gives candidates without a long work history a meaningful edge in Providence-area interviews.
